Abstract

The utility model discloses an online detecting device of shelf depreciation of a high-voltage cable used for a high-speed railway engine. The online detecting device includes a console, a shelf depreciation detector, a testing transformer and a voltage regulator. An input end of a double-shield isolation transformer connects with a power supply of 380V. An output end of the double-shield isolation transformer connects with the voltage regulator, a low-voltage filter and the testing transformer successively. The testing transformer connects with a filtering inducer through a lead. The filtering inducer connects with a capacitive divider and a calibration capacitor separately through high-voltage leads. The console connects with the voltage regulator through a control cable. The console connects with the testing transformer through a current measuring wire. The console connects with the capacitive divider through coaxial cables. The shelf depreciation detector connects with the testing transformer, the capacitive divider and the calibration capacitor through the coaxial cables separately. By using the online detecting device of shelf depreciation of the high-voltage cable used for the high-speed railway engine in the utility model, the background interference of shelf depreciation is lowered to less than 10 pC. The detection of the online detecting device is accurate, thereby guaranteeing the safety and the normal traveling of the high-speed rail engine.

Background technology
High-speed railway is that operation management mode, the marketing and a capital collection that collects the state-of-the-art railway technology of each item, advanced person is in interior ten minutes complicated system engineering; Have high efficiency transportation, it has comprised many-sided technology and management such as infrastructure construction, rolling stock configuration, the car operation rule of standing.A series of outstanding technology economy advantages such as it is fast with its speed, capacity is big, energy consumption is low, pollution is light, take up an area of less with security performance is good have caused the attention of countries in the world.States such as Germany, Britain, Italy, Spain competitively develop, and also have many countries and regions actively to establish.
Shelf depreciation is a kind of very small discharge, and it comes out with the embodied of discharge charge amount, and unit is slightly coulomb: i.e. pC.According to the current national standard code, for the crosslinked cable of the special-purpose electrical network 27.5kV of high ferro, under the industrial frequency experiment voltage of 37.5kV, the partial discharge quantity of cable can not surpass 10pC.In the partial discharge test system, the discharge capacity of 10pC is equal to the pulsed discharge of 100mV; Will be under the trial voltage of 37.5kV; Measure the 100mV pulse, it is measured difficulty and well imagines that this should improve the sensitivity of detecting instrument; Detect this small discharge, improve the antijamming capability of system again.
Then desired power is just big more more soon for the speed of locomotive, and improving the best mode of power is to improve the electric pressure of transmission line of electricity, and the employed electric pressure of China Express Railway is 27.5kV at present.One section high-tension cable is arranged on locomotive, because the requirement of construction technology, this section cable must be in the locomotive production run, carry out Partial Discharge Detection at the locomotive top,, conform to quality requirements to guarantee the high-tension cable of installing, could guarantee normally to move.The company standard that provides according to Siemens; Require the local discharging level of this section cable maybe can not surpass background+5pC above 15pC; Because the condition of locomotive produced on-site is very complicated, comprises various electromagnetic interference sources, it is very big that background interference is put in on-the-spot office; Often background interference reaches more than the 50pC, can't carry out online detection according to above-mentioned standard at all.Present on-line measuring device; Form by pressure regulator, testing transformer, control desk, filter inductor, capacitive divider and PD meter; Because ground connection, isolation and the filtering measure that there is no need; In testing process, can't reach the detection requirement, this is a maximum potential safety hazard in the present express locomotive operation at all.

Its principle of work is: the 380V power supply by the user external world provides, directly insert double shield isolating transformer 3, by the extraneous interference of double shield isolating transformer 3 filterings; Output to pressure regulator 4 again, by pressure regulator 4 with voltage-regulation to 0-380V, output to low-voltage filter 11; After the filtering through low-voltage filter device 11,, boost to 0-80kV through testing transformer 5 for testing transformer 5 provides clean 0-380V power supply; Use high-voltage power supply as test; The output terminal of testing transformer 5 is connected to the input end of hv filtering inductor 6 through a lead, after the interference that is produced by filter inductor 6 filtering transformers and high-voltage connection, directly receives the high-tension cable that is placed on the locomotive top and tests; Be connected with capacitive divider 8 and calibration capacitor 7 through high-voltage connection 14 respectively simultaneously; The effect of capacitive divider 8 is to measure the high pressure output voltage, simultaneously as the coupling capacitance of office's discharge signal, after will being gathered by office's discharge signal of test cable; Offer PD meter 2 and measure, the effect of calibration capacitor 7 is that measuring system is carried out the verification calibration.
Control desk 1 is connected with pressure regulator 4 through umbilical cable 10; Control function such as the on/off switch of control pressure regulator 4, voltage-regulation, zero-bit are closed a floodgate, high-low limit is spacing, its CM-A interface is connected with the CM-A interface of testing transformer 5 through current measurement line 12 simultaneously, measures the high-potting electric current; Its KVM interface is connected with the KVM interface of capacitive divider 8 through coaxial wire 15; High tension voltage during experiment with measuring, the ARC interface of control desk 1 is connected with the ARC interface of capacitive divider 8 through coaxial wire 15, and whether the monitoring high tension loop has spark to produce; So that timely cutoff high, protection equipment is not damaged; The KVM interface of PD meter 2 is connected with the KVM interface of testing transformer 5 through coaxial wire 15; The also high tension voltage during experiment with measuring; But because it is to convert through the instrument coil, data are not very accurate, so only for reference; The PD interface of PD meter 2 is connected with the PD interface of capacitive divider 8 through coaxial wire 15; Measure by the office's discharge signal on the examination cable, the CAL interface of PD meter 2 is connected through the CAL interface of coaxial wire 15 with calibration capacitor 7, and measuring system is calibrated calibration.
Described double shield isolating transformer 3, pressure regulator 4, testing transformer 5, filter inductor 6, capacitive divider 8, calibration capacitor 7, control desk 1, low-voltage filter device 11 and PD meter 2 all are connected same and the external world independently on the earthing device; Can not with the zero line in the factory power distribution network and the grounded screen in workshop, anti-Thunder Network links together.In the workshop of locomotive works and on the vehicle; Many powerful consumers are arranged, and like ITBT frequency conversion DC-AC conversion device, locomotive-platform contact radio station, large power air-conditioned or the like, they adopt powerful frequency modulation mostly; Frequency conversion AC and DC motor; Regulate the high noisies such as controllable silicon of conduction angle, the electric equipment of high interference, the zero line of these equipment, ground wire, the earthing of casing etc. are ambiguous often, causes the ground in workshop that too many interference is arranged on the net.If the ground connection of shelf depreciation system is attached thereto together, interference will get into the measurement of partial discharge system through ground wire at an easy rate.Therefore, the measurement of partial discharge system requirements must have oneself, independent ground loop, the ground connection of each equipment also must be followed the principle of the capable ground connection of single-point star, and the round-robin ground wire can not be arranged.

When using the utility model; Because there are many production lines at scene, user workshop, many locomotives are produced simultaneously, every locomotive type difference; Has plenty of the train head; Have plenty of middle compartment, the interference classification that is produced is also different, therefore can only carry out Partial Discharge Detection in the place away from these interference sources as far as possible.
When carrying out locomotive,,, need cable grounding and locomotive ground connection branch are come, to reduce the interference that ground loop causes for preventing the ground connection of circulating because the locomotive shell links together through track and workshop steel structure with the high-tension cable partial discharge test.
The power requirement of whole shelf depreciation device has an independently electric power system; Promptly direct 10kV (or 35kV) inlet wire from factory; At factory's distribution substation an independent 10kV/380V or reduction transformer (35kV/380V) are set, make a distinction fully with factory other consumer; The examination district couples together at the private cable more than 150 meters with a length from the distribution substation to the shelf depreciation, and this root cable adopts copper strips phase-splitting shielding, adds 1 core electric welding machine line again as ground wire, last steel-tape armouring.
After all equipment wiring are accomplished, just can carry out office according to the following steps and put detection:
(1), after all lines of inspection are accurate, closing test zone fence under the situation of confirming not have unrelated person to get into the examination district, is connected the 380V experiment power supply to double shield isolating transformer 3;
(2), pressure regulator 4 power supplys that close, control desk 1 power supply that closes, PD meter 2 power supplys close;
(3), utilize the calibrating signal on the PD meter 2, measuring system is carried out the mark calibration;
(4), the high tension voltage that closes, regulate pressure regulator 4 output voltages, make the output high pressure of testing transformer 5 reach the needed 37.5kV of test;
(5), measure and to be put numerical value by the office of examination cable this moment, note;
(6), reduction pressure regulator 4 output voltages arrive zero, cutoff high voltage, cut-out control desk 1 power supply, cut-out PD meter 2 power supplys, cut-out pressure regulator 4 power supplys, the 380V power supply of the outside access of cut-out, off-test.
Adopt the utility model to test, background interference is controlled in below the 10pC, according to the company standard of Siemens; Underproof this section high ferro locomotive cable, its partial discharge quantity is not more than 15pC under the voltage of 37.5kV; Or be not more than 5pC with the background interference difference; Guarantee to detect the degree of accuracy of data, measured actual office value of putting of this section cable effectively, got rid of the operating hidden danger of high ferro.
